CAP Congratulates Mr. Javed Alam Odho on His Appointment as Inspector General of Police, Sindh
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Karachi: The Consumers Association of Pakistan (CAP) extends its sincere and warm congratulations to Mr. Javed Alam Odho on assuming charge as Inspector General of Police, Sindh.

On behalf of CAP, Kaukab Iqbal, Chairman, expressed that Mr. Odho’s appointment to this prestigious position is a well?deserved recognition of his distinguished career, administrative competence, and meritorious services to law enforcement.

CAP also places on record its deep appreciation for Mr. Odho’s commendable contributions during his tenure as Additional Inspector General of Police, noting his focused and result?oriented efforts in crime control, maintenance of public order, and strengthening traffic enforcement mechanisms. His leadership has been instrumental in enhancing operational efficiency, enforcing traffic discipline, and improving public trust in policing institutions—efforts widely acknowledged by citizens and civil society organizations.

Mr. Iqbal further stated that Mr. Odho’s professional approach, commitment to the rule of law, and emphasis on accountability and public service have set high standards within the police force. CAP is confident that under his capable leadership as IGP Sindh, the province will witness further strengthening of law enforcement, improved governance, and enhanced public safety.

On this auspicious occasion, CAP also extends its best wishes for the New Year, hoping it brings Mr. Odho continued success, good health, and further achievements in the discharge of his official responsibilities.

These congratulations and good wishes are conveyed on behalf of the Managing Committee and the Women Wing of the Consumers Association of Pakistan.
